Summary:
Meta’s mission is to give people the power to build community and bring the world closer together. The RL Packaging Team is focused on delivering consumer product packaging for all RL products (Mixed Reality, AI Glasses, Accessories and new devices). We focus on packaging that is sustainable, design‑focused, and enhances the customer experience. The RL Packaging team seeks a Technical Program Manager who has strong experience as a TPM in packaging development. As the packaging TPM, you will be responsible for collecting cross‑functional inputs to support the team in designing, validating, and delivering product packaging at scale. This role will focus on package sustaining activities in support of international expansion initiatives. The products we work on help connect the world closer together and we contribute with each box we design.
Required Skills: Technical Program Manager, Packaging Responsibilities:
Technical Program Manager for RL packaging products including Quest, Ray‑Ban Meta, Wearables, Accessories and new devices
End-to-end coordination of packaging engineering, design, and validation from product discovery through launch
Lead collaboration with industrial design, engineering, creative, legal, product management, compliance and operations to realize packaging vision and content on the packaging/in‑box
Guide the team through ambiguous packaging definition, sourcing cross‑functional inputs and influencing to find an optimized solution
Drive the execution of the schedule and manage day to day activities of the program
Present program updates to leadership, distilling key program information and highlighting risks and recommended mitigations
Implement process improvements and best practices for the organization
Collaborate closely with APAC suppliers for packaging builds
10% international and domestic travel
Minimum Qualifications:
3+ years of hands‑on program management experience
Demonstrated proficiency in consumer electronics design cycles
Experience working with contract manufacturers, packaging suppliers, and creative agencies
BS in engineering or equivalent industry experience
Preferred Qualifications:
BS in mechanical, packaging, or structural engineering
Public Compensation: $102,000/year to $157,000/year + bonus + equity + benefits
